Whereas antigenic drift affects all strains of influenza, antigenic shift only affects influenza a, as it has a broad range of animal reservoirs. The genome of influenza is comprised for eight. Ag shift caused by 2 virus combine together and form a new virus while ag drift cause antigenic matter at the surface at the virus. While influenza viruses change all the time due to antigenic drift, antigenic shift happens less frequently. Both influenza a and b viruses undergo antigenic drift. Antigenic shift can produce a version of influenza virus that no person's immune system has antibodies to protect against.

Whereas antigenic drift affects all strains of influenza, antigenic shift only affects influenza a, as it has a broad range of animal reservoirs.
